The BSM is awarded to a person in any branch of the military service, who, while serving in any capacity with the Armed Forces of the United States after 6 Dec 41, shall have distinguished himself by heroic or meritorious achievement or service, not involving participation in aerial flight, in connection with military operations against an armed enemy. The award recognizes acts of heroism performed in ground combat if they are of lesser degree than that required for the Silver Star. It also recognizes single acts of merit and meritorious service if the achievement or service is of a lesser degree than that deemed worthy of the Legion of Merit (LOM); but such service must have been accomplished with distinction. AIR FORCE EVALUATION: AFPC/DPSID recommends denial. There is no official documentation in the applicant’s record, nor was any provided, to verify he was recommended for award of the BSM. In order for the applicant’s request to be reasonably considered he will need to provide a recommendation made by someone with firsthand knowledge of the act/achievement, a proposed citation, and eyewitness statements from those who saw the act/achievement. To grant relief would be contrary to the criteria established by DoDM 1348.33, Manual of Military Decorations and Awards, the Secretary of the Air Force, Chief of Staff, and/or the War Department. The complete DPSID evaluation is at Exhibit C. SAF/MRBP concurs with the recommendation of AFPC/DPSID due to the lack of verification the applicant was recommended for award of the BSM.
